A Teacher Turned First Lady
Before Brigitte Macron assumed her role as France’s First Lady, she was a dedicated teacher. She began her career as an educator, teaching literature at the Collège Lucie-Berger in Strasbourg during the 1980s. Later, she transitioned to teaching French and Latin at Lycée la Providence, a Jesuit high school in Amiens, where she continued to make a positive impact on her students.
In 2015, Brigitte decided to step away from her teaching career to support her husband, Emmanuel Macron, in his political endeavors. This pivotal decision marked the beginning of her journey into the world of French politics and the life of a First Lady.
Family and Personal Life
Brigitte Macron’s personal life has been a subject of interest and intrigue. She was born into the Trogneux family, who were the proprietors of the well-known Chocolaterie Trogneux, a five-generation chocolate business founded in 1872 in Amiens, France. Although she initially pursued teaching, her life took a different course when she met a young student named Emmanuel Macron.
In 1993, at the age of 40, Brigitte crossed paths with 15-year-old Emmanuel Macron at La Providence High School, where she was a teacher and he, a student and classmate of her daughter Laurence. Their connection deepened over the years, ultimately leading to her divorce from banker André-Louis Auzière in January 2006, followed by her marriage to Macron in October 2007.
